How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Haiku-Pauwela?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Haiku-Pauwela Studio Apartments | $2,066 | $1,900 | $2,300 |
| Haiku-Pauwela 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,672 | $1,915 | $8,051 |
Haiku-Pauwela 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,618 | $2,400 | $9,908 |
| Haiku-Pauwela 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,627 | $3,100 | $4,800 |
| Haiku-Pauwela 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,500 | $5,500 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Haiku-Pauwela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Haiku-Pauwela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Haiku-Pauwela is $3,618.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Haiku-Pauwela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Haiku-Pauwela is a 886 square feet unit starting from $3,279 at Kaulana Mahina.
What is the average size for Haiku-Pauwela 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Haiku-Pauwela is currently 838 sq ft.
